AFRE.L, Afren The cheapest stock we cover /OML 26 revisited - Raising TP to 220p; Stay OW
Morgan Stanley & Co. International plc
Rating: Overweight
Share Price: 157p
Oil & Gas: Attractive
Target: 220p
52-Week Range: 164-77
Mkt. Cap(mn): US$2,259
ModelWare EPS: 0.03US$ (FY 12/'10), 0.17US$ (FY 12/'11)
We raise our Afren (OW) base case NAV by c.20% to 222p and set our 220p TP (prev. 185p) in
line with our Base NAV, for 40% potential upside. After working with the company, and reflecting
the explicit terms of the contract, we have remodeled the OML 26 oil field (First Deal through FHN
Unlocking the Prize, 10/21/10). Afren now trades at an 8% discount to Core NAV and is the
cheapest E&P that we cover. We see 3 near-term catalysts that could narrow the valuation gap:
1) First oil from Ebok (late Feb); 2) Presidential decree of the Nigerian Petroleum Industry Bill,
PIB (April); and 3) results from the first well (Block 1101, Madagascar) in the nine well. Afren will
present at our East Africa E&P Conference on 16 March and report FY results on 29 March.
